BDO in East Africa is a member firm of BDO International.

We operate fully-fledged offices located in Kenya, Tanzania, Uganda, Ethiopia, Rwanda, Burundi, the Republic of Congo and the Democratic Republic of Congo With a combined professional team of over 200, we take pride in being part of a network that has exceptional capabilities, locally, regionally and globally.

Our professionals have embraced the mission to serve African businesses and contribute to the economic growth of the continent.
Previously known as DCDM, we have a long-established presence in the region. We have been active in Kenya since 1996, in Tanzania since 1997, Uganda since 1999 and Ethiopia since 2013.
Over the years, we have built  a large portfolio of clients from both the public and private sector.
We service small and medium enterprises to large corporate bodies and cross-border corporations.
BDO in East Africa has also advised several government bodies, regional organisations and donor agencies within the region.
